Geo Location Information for 77.93.223.221 IP Address. The IP Address 77.93.223.221 is located at 49.1952 latitude and 16.608 longitude in Czech Republic. Friendly Location for the IP Address is Jihomoravsky Kraj, Brno, Czech Republic, 602 00